Resultados da pesquisa a pedido "mocha"

2 a resposta

Qual é a melhor maneira de testar os Manipuladores de Eventos de Rolagem de Janela com Enzima?

Eu tenho trabalhado em um aplicativo React com uma nova equipe e surgiu a discussão sobre a criação de testes de unidade para componentes que acionam métodos em eventos window.scroll. Então, vamos tomar esse componente como um exemplo. import ...

2 a resposta

Tempo limite de alteração do Mocha para afterEach

Estou escrevendo um aplicativo de nó com mocha e chai. Alguns dos testes chamam uma API externa para testes de integração, que podem levar até 90 segundos para executar a ação. Para fazer a limpeza corretamente, defini umafterEach()-block, que ...

1 a resposta

Como adiciono uma expectativa mocha de que um método auxiliar será chamado?

Estou movendo um método de um controlador para um auxiliar; o método agora será chamado a partir da visualização. Anteriormente, no meu controlador, eu tinha def show @things = gather_things ende no meu teste funcional eu tive test "show ...

1 a resposta

Mocking Redis Constructor com Sinon

Estou tentando descobrir uma maneira de zombar de redis neste módulo: //module.js const Redis = require('ioredis'); const myFunction = { exists: (thingToCheck) { let redis_client = new Redis( 6379, process.env.REDIS_URL, { connectTimeout: 75, ...

1 a resposta

Execute mochajs de forma assíncrona (semelhante à AMD)

Posso carregar o módulo mocha de forma assíncrona no navegador? Eu posso fazer isso com certeza com chai. Existe alguma solução alternativa para fazer o mocha funcionar no estilo amd? require.config({ baseUrl: "/scripts", paths: { "mocha": ...

1 a resposta

fazendo com que o relatório de cobertura nyc / istambul funcione com texto datilografado

Estou lutando para obter uma cobertura adequada com nyc / istanbul para o meu projeto de texto datilografado / mocha / gulp. Eu tentei várias abordagens, algumas delas parecem incapazes de usar mapas de origem e outras falhas devido ats-node/tsc ...

1 a resposta

stub sinon não substituindo a função.

Eu tentei um módulo fictício e o stub, mas não funciona. the app.js function foo() { return run_func() } function run_func() { return '1' } exports._test = {foo: foo, run_func: run_func}o test.js app = require("./app.js")._test ...

5 a resposta

"Node --debug" e "node --debug-brk" são inválidos

Eu atualizei o nó (v8.1.2). Quando eu quero depurar meu projeto de teste anterior no nodejs usando o NTVS (no visual studio 2017), recebi o seguinte erro: Erro padrão: (nó: 5292) [DEP0062] Aviso de reprovação:node --debug enode --debug-brk são ...

1 a resposta

Esperar erro de tipo de asserções -> expect (…) .toExist não é uma função

Estou testando um aplicativo nodejs. Onde encontro esse erro ao executar o teste. O script de teste está abaixo: .expect( (res) => { expect(res.headers['x-auth']).toExist(); expect(res.body._id).toExist(); expect(res.body.email).toBe(email); })o ...

7 a resposta

nodemon '' mocha 'não é reconhecido como comando interno ou externo, programa operável ou arquivo em lotes

Executando umteste [https://github.com/StephenGrider/MongoCasts/tree/030-finding-particular]para um projeto nodejs no windows 10 com a linha em package.json como: "test": "nodemon --exec 'mocha -R min'"Eu recebo: > nodemon --exec 'mocha -R min' ...